### Ticket: Order-cutoff drift at Millgrain Bakery

The Ovenline service in production enforces a 2 p.m. order cutoff, but staging still uses the old 4 p.m. rule, so reviewers keep approving changes against the wrong behavior. Please verify the diff against production values, not staging. For reference, the production cutoff configuration as currently deployed is shown below.

settings of fawip-yadug:
[druath]
port = 3000
region = north-4
host = druath.qirvanworks.corp
timeout_ms = 1500
retries = 1

**Alert: AuditTrail viewer query latency exceeded threshold**

This alert fires when the Corvane audit-log viewer's p95 query time stays above five seconds for ten consecutive minutes. It usually indicates an unindexed filter combination or a retention-job backlog. Do not restart the viewer service first; check the indexer queue depth instead. The full triage procedure for new responders is documented here.

wiki page, tahaf-tajog: https://jira.ordindyn.corp/pipeline

## Deployment

LiftSim deploys as a single container per region, fronted by the Corvette scheduler. Rollouts are blue-green; the simulator replays the last hour of dispatch traffic against the new build before traffic shifts. If replay divergence exceeds the threshold, the rollout aborts automatically and pages on-call. Logs land in the usual aggregate stream. The simulator reads its runtime parameters at startup, and the current production set is shown below.

deployment values, yafop-fajop:
BRIATH_PIN=7272
BRIATH_METRICS_HOST=metrics.briath.qorvelworks.internal
BRIATH_LOG_LEVEL=info
BRIATH_TENANT=casath

Runbook — sealed exam papers, Norwick Testing Centre. Papers arrive in tamper-evident crates from the Aldmere print facility, usually around 07:30. Don't open anything; just check seals and count crates against the manifest. Store them in the proctor's vault until exam morning. The courier hand-over instruction is below — keep it to yourself.

handover note for yagef-bagep: the drudor pelius courier leaves the kasdor zorvan norir ledger at gate 8016 under passcode 755406